Binotto denies claims that Ferrari wants Cowell

Mattia Binotto has denied reports that Ferrari is looking to sign Andy Cowell, claiming that he's happy with the current staff. As the head of Mercedes's High-Performance Powertrains, Cowell is a key reason why the German team has been so dominant in the hybrid era that started in 2014. It was announced in June that he was to step away from his role. Since then, reports have claimed that Ferrari approached him with the hope that he could rebuild their power unit department, and that he turned the offer down.
